Portugal Golden Visa in Sum

The program is also known as ARI (Residence Permit for Investment Activity), and it is the most popular among countries with Golden Visa. You can apply for the Golden Visa if you’re a non-EU, non-EEA, or non-Swiss citizen.

Since 2012, the program has raised more than €6 billion in the country.

Investors obtain Portuguese residency after they make a qualifying investment and submit necessary documents. Family members of the main applicants can also apply for the program. It has attracted family members as well because of the amenities Portugal offers. These include a mild climate, a safe and beautiful country as well as a high quality of life in an affordable country.

At the first step, Portugal Golden Visa allows you to live, work, and study in Portugal. Citizenship may also become available when you satisfy the qualifications in five years.

Visa-Free Access to Hundreds of Countries

The Golden Visa Program registers applicants in the Schengen Area central system. In this way, you can travel within and between any Schengen state without a visa.

Furthermore, once you hold your citizenship, you’ll have visa-free access to 188 countries.

No Need To Settle in Portugal

The program doesn’t require you to move to Portugal to keep your resident status. Golden Visa to Portugal requires only seven days of stay in Portugal throughout a year.

However, you’ll still keep the right to live and work in Portugal. You can also establish and run your business in Portugal as well.

Family Members Can Be Included

Your family members can simultaneously apply to the program with you:

  • Your spouse,
  • Your children under the age of 18,
  • Your dependent children under the age of 26 if they’re full-time students and not married,
  • Your parents over the age of 65.

EU Citizenship

After you successfully hold your Golden Visa Portugal for five years, you can apply for citizenship. Portuguese citizenship also means European citizenship. You must fulfill the following requirements to apply for citizenship:

  • You must have clean criminal records both from your home country and Portugal
  • You mustn’t have outstanding tax payments in Portugal
  • You must pass a basic language test in Portuguese.

Tax Benefits

If you consider becoming a tax resident in Portugal, certain benefits can apply via your Golden Visa Portugal. However, note that you’ll not become a tax resident unless you stay in Portugal for more than 183 days.

The non-habitual residency (NHR) program in Portugal makes you exempt from income taxes for a duration of ten years.

Real Estate Acquisition

This is the most popular option among other investment options of Golden Visa Portugal. Find the real estate options below:

  • Real estate purchase for worth more than €500,000 in Portugal
    • If it’s in a low-density area: The minimum requirement drops to €400,000
  • Real estate purchase for real estate older than 30 years and located in an urban rehabilitation area. Also, renovate it for a minimum of €350,000 in Portugal
    • Again, if it’s in a low-density area: The minimum requirement drops to €280,000

According to the recent changes in the program, you cannot buy residential property in Lisbon, Porto, and the coastal towns of the mainland. However, commercial properties in these locations can still qualify you for Golden Visa program.

Fund Subscription

You need to make a minimum of €500,000 subscription in a qualifying Portuguese fund.

Other Investment Options

  • Capital transfer: A capital transfer of a minimum of €1.5 million to Portugal.
  • Company set up: Creating a minimum of 10 jobs in a Portuguese business owned by the main applicant.
  • Donation of
    • €250,000 in preserving national heritage
    • €500,000 in a research and development activity
